Removing obstacles for more than 2,200 projects with a total capital of nearly 5.9 million billion VND

PHẠM ĐÔNG |

The Government has reviewed and proposed that the Politburo and the National Assembly remove obstacles for over 2,200 projects with a total capital of nearly 5.9 million billion VND.

This information was given by Politburo member and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h when presenting the Government's report on the socio-economic situation in the first months of 2025, at the 9th session of the 15th National Assembly, on the morning of May 5.

The Prime Minister emphasized the strict implementation of the work program and conclusions of the Central Steering Committee on preventing and combating corruption, waste and negativity; focusing on perfecting institutions and solutions for preventing corruption; strengthening inspection, examination and implementation of inspection conclusions.

Accordingly, the Government has deployed 1,538 administrative inspections and 4,135 specialized inspections and examinations; detected economic violations of VND 2,058 billion, 720 hectares of land; recommended reviewing and handling administrative procedures for 381 collectives and 1,083 individuals; transferred 26 cases and 15 subjects to the investigation agency for further reviewing and handling.

"Wasting prevention and control work has received special attention and achieved positive results, especially the handling of backlogged and prolonged works and projects that cause loss and waste of resources.

In particular, the Government has completed reviewing and proposing to the Politburo and the National Assembly to remove obstacles for over 2,200 projects with a total capital of nearly VND5.9 million billion (equivalent to about 235 billion USD) and a total land use scale of about 347,000 hectares", the Prime Minister stated.

In addition to the achieved results, the Prime Minister also pointed out limitations and shortcomings that need to be resolutely addressed, in which decentralization and delegation of power are not thorough, and are still concentrated at the central level, causing congestion and inconvenience to subordinates.

To achieve the growth target of 8% or more, the scale of the economy reaches over 500 billion USD, GDP per capita in 2025 reaches over 5,000 USD, the Prime Minister emphasized the priority of promoting growth associated with macroeconomic stability, controlling inflation, striving to increase State budget revenue by over 15%.

In 2025, it is necessary to abolish at least 30% of unnecessary business investment conditions; reduce at least 30% of the time for handling administrative procedures; reduce at least 30% of administrative procedure costs.

"Extensively reforming State governance, perfecting the organizational model of the political system with the spirit of not doing half, doing to the end, doing thoroughly", the Prime Minister noted.

The Prime Minister aims to improve the effectiveness of recovering lost and misappropriated money and assets in criminal cases related to economics and corruption. Effectively implement approved compulsory transfer plans for weak banks.

The Prime Minister said that it is necessary to allocate resources to exempt tuition fees for preschool and primary school students, ensuring the right purpose and effectiveness from the 2025-2026 school year. Mobilize resources to build boarding houses for ethnic minority students.

Along with that is to continue investing in developing preventive medicine and grassroots health care; constantly improving the quality of health services from medical examination and treatment to people's health care, aiming to exempt hospital fees for all people.

"This is a difficult task, but if we do well and grow well, we can do it at the current budget collection rate," the Prime Minister affirmed and made a request to urgently complete the construction and put Bach Mai Hospital, Viet Duc Hospital, Facility 2 into operation in 2025.
